Road Rash Customs was to powder coat my 1959 Cavalier 72 Coke machine. It was agreed that all body work would be done to the machine and all rust would be removed and replaced with new sheet metal. I was told that the machine would be done in 2 weeks. After 3 months I received the machine back and it was horrible. There was dust imbedded in the clear coat, no body work was done to the metal. On the inside tub the powder fell out of 3 of the corners because there was dirt built up that  was not removed during or after sandblasting. When the white was applied it turned to an off yellow in different large areas. On the side of the machine it looks as if the red was applied with a spray can. You can see the stroke marks, I thought powder coating blended together. I brought this up to the owner (who is the person who did the work) and they told me it was just dust from the delivery, I could not get it to wipe off. This machine is suppose to be worth 3 to 5,000 after restoration. Now the machine is worth 1400. I asked for my money back and was given the run around. I put a stop payment on the check only because of all the excuses I was being told why I couldn't meet them to get my money back until it was fixed properly. I was told they would try and fix it, but to me if you cant get it right the first time then how you going to do it better the next. If it would of been a couple scratches or some other little defect then I can see, that stuff happens. But when you cant even prep before painting properly to where 4 inch chunks of dirt falls from 3 corners and removes the coating, that is unacceptable. I am part to blame cause I have not had the time to disassemble the machine for them to pick it up. Now they want to file charges. But I feel when you promise a service then you should follow through with it. They asked me to just pay $300 and call it good, which I am just paying and will find a professional powder coater to paint my coke box.
